I’ve always thought male leads get more of a leeway than female leads by fans and it seems like this show is no different.


When Rudra was manhandling Preesha, I saw plenty of justification for it and even I tried to understand his mindset (who wouldn’t be aggressive against the murderer of their loved one?). We said this is how Rudra is, his love and hate are a part of him.


But Preesha? Just because she’s not realising her love, her character doesn’t get the same understanding? We are forgetting that despite her not questioning her feelings, she is still WITH Rudra. After what he did in the past 1-2 weeks, she could’ve left him but she doesn’t want to. In fact she said she will never leave him. She was hurt by his closeness with Keerti, made that aware to him too. She cried when he hurt himself. The last few episodes she did everything to save Rudra. Why are we forgetting that she has NOT seen the side of Yuvraj we all have? Has she seen what he says and does behind the scenes? Only we have. Even then she doesn’t give a crap about him but let’s not forget she was meant to marry him, yet ended up with Rudra. Yuvraj keeps coming to her and saying I still love you, I will always be there with you. There must be some guilt in her that she doesn’t feel the same hate as we do (we know so much more as an audience!) If everything happens now, how do we expect the show to have longevity?


Does Preesha become that frustrating only because she’s not questioning her feelings? Despite the fact she’s doing everything a girl in love would do. If Rudra doesn’t believe anything she says, what is she meant to do? First she was quiet but now she’s giving it back to him.


These are the things you have to expect in Ekta shows especially in the MU tracks because ultimately when the good times come, they are so worth it.


All I’m saying is: cut Preesha some slack. Just because she’s not realising her feelings, doesn’t make her a butchered character. She too has her flaws as Rudra does but we seem to find excuses for the latter more easily. It’s a love story, misunderstandings will be there and not everything can according to our wish. Just because we want her to realise her feelings now, doesn’t mean the writers have planned it that way.
